Ingredients for - Rosemary-Parmesan Biscuits

1. 1 c. all-purpose flour -
2. 1/2 c. chopped walnuts -
3. 1 tbsp. finely chopped fresh rosemary -
4. 1/2 tsp. salt -
5. Pinch cayenne pepper -
6. Pinch freshly ground black pepper -
7. 1 stick butter -
8. 1 1/2 c. freshly grated Parmesan cheese (6 ounces) -

How to cook deliciously - Rosemary-Parmesan Biscuits

1. Stage

In a large bowl, stir together the flour, walnuts, rosemary, salt, and peppers.

2. Stage

With a mixer on medium-high speed, cream butter in a medium bowl until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Add cheese and beat on low speed until well combined. Add the flour mixture and beat just until blended.

3. Stage

Divide the dough into 2 pieces and roll each piece into a 1 1/2 inch- diameter log. Wrap each log in plastic wrap and refrigerate at least 30 minutes, or until easy to slice.

4. Stage

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Grease 2 large baking sheets.

5. Stage

Cut the logs crosswise into 3/8-inch-thick slices and place flat on baking sheets. Bake 12 to 15 minutes, or until golden brown. Transfer to wire racks to cool.
